Understanding Robotic Process Automation (RPA)

What is RPA?

Robotic Process Automation (RPA) is the use of software robots (bots) to automate repetitive, rule-based business processes. These bots interact with digital systems just like humans do—by clicking, typing, and navigating applications—to execute tasks without errors.

RPA is non-invasive, meaning it does not require changes to existing IT infrastructure. It works across various platforms, integrating with enterprise software like ERP systems, CRMs, and cloud applications.

Key Features of RPA:

Feature

Description

Rule-based Automation

Automates tasks with structured, predefined rules.

User Interface Interaction

Bots perform actions like clicking, typing, and copying data.

Non-Intrusive

Works with existing software without modification.

Scalability

Can be scaled up or down based on demand.

Audit & Compliance

Tracks every action for regulatory purposes.

Unlike traditional automation that requires coding, RPA is designed for business users. Many RPA tools offer drag-and-drop functionality, making automation accessible even for non-technical professionals.

How Does Robotic Process Automation (RPA) Work?

Robotic Process Automation (RPA) operates by mimicking human actions in digital environments to complete tasks efficiently and accurately. At its core, RPA automates structured, rule-based processes by interacting with software applications, just like a human user would—but at a faster speed and without errors.

1. The Core Components of RPA

RPA systems are built around three fundamental components that enable automation:

Component

Description

Bot Creator (Design Studio)

A development interface where users design automation workflows by recording human interactions or defining logic.

Bot Runner (Execution Engine)

The component that executes automation scripts on a virtual or physical machine without human intervention.

Orchestrator (Control Panel)

A central hub that manages, schedules, and monitors bots across different environments.

These components work together to ensure smooth bot deployment, monitoring, and governance in an organization.

2. How RPA Works – Step-by-Step Process

To understand how RPA functions in a real-world scenario, let’s break it down into a structured workflow:

Step 1: Identifying the Process to Automate

Before implementing RPA, organizations must analyze which tasks are repetitive, rule-based, and structured. Common candidates include:

  • Data entry and validation
  • Invoice processing
  • Customer query handling
  • Report generation

Step 2: Developing the Automation Workflow

  • The bot is programmed to mimic human interactions with applications.
  • Users can either record actions (such as mouse clicks and keyboard inputs) or define custom logic.
  • Integration with AI and OCR (Optical Character Recognition) can be added to process unstructured data.

Step 3: Bot Deployment and Execution

  • The RPA bot is deployed on a system where it performs tasks based on predefined rules.
  • It interacts with multiple applications, databases, and systems, just like a human worker.
  • The bot executes tasks at high speed while ensuring data accuracy and compliance.

Step 4: Monitoring and Managing Bots

  • RPA orchestrators provide a dashboard to monitor bot performance.
  • Bots can be scheduled to run at specific times or triggered by events.
  • If errors occur, alerts and logs help diagnose issues for quick resolution.

Step 5: Continuous Optimization and Scaling

  • Organizations analyze bot performance to identify further automation opportunities.
  • RPA solutions are scaled across departments for maximum efficiency.

3. Types of RPA Bots

RPA bots come in different forms, each suited for different automation needs.

Type of RPA Bot

Description

Example Use Case

Attended Bots

Require human intervention; work alongside employees.

Customer support chatbots that suggest responses to agents.

Unattended Bots

Fully autonomous and execute tasks without human input.

Automatic invoice processing and data entry.

Hybrid Bots

A combination of attended and unattended bots for dynamic workflows.

HR onboarding that requires both manual approvals and automated document processing.

4. Technologies That Power RPA

To perform complex automation tasks, RPA integrates with various advanced technologies:

A. Artificial Intelligence (AI) & Machine Learning (ML)

  • Enhances decision-making capabilities in automation workflows.
  • Helps bots analyze unstructured data (e.g., customer sentiment analysis).

B. Optical Character Recognition (OCR)

  • Enables bots to extract data from scanned documents, PDFs, and handwritten notes.
  • Useful for invoice processing, bank statements, and legal document analysis.

C. Natural Language Processing (NLP)

  • Allows bots to understand human language in emails, chat messages, and voice commands.
  • Useful in customer service automation and sentiment analysis.

D. APIs & Integration

  • RPA integrates with ERP, CRM, databases, and third-party applications via APIs.
  • Ensures seamless communication between legacy systems and modern cloud platforms.

Benefits of Robotic Process Automation (RPA)

Robotic Process Automation (RPA) offers significant advantages for businesses across various industries. By automating repetitive, rule-based tasks, organizations can enhance efficiency, reduce costs, and improve accuracy

  1. Increased Efficiency and Productivity

One of the biggest advantages of RPA is its ability to perform tasks faster than humans. Bots work 24/7 without breaks, vacations, or fatigue, leading to higher output in less time.

How RPA Boosts Productivity:

  • Automates high-volume tasks like data entry, invoice processing, and payroll management.
  • Reduces processing time by handling tasks in seconds instead of minutes or hours.
  • Frees up employees for higher-value tasks like strategic planning and customer engagement.

2. Cost Savings and ROI

RPA reduces operational costs by eliminating the need for human intervention in repetitive tasks. Organizations can save 30% to 50% on labor costs by deploying RPA bots instead of hiring additional employees.

Cost Benefits of RPA:

  • Minimizes labor costs while increasing output.
  • Reduces costly human errors that lead to financial losses.
  • Provides a quick return on investment (ROI)—many businesses recover their RPA implementation costs within 6-12 months.
